Psychiatry

Psychiatry is a branch of medicine that deals with the diagnosis, treatment, and management of mental disorders. The psychiatry department focuses on assessing and treating patients’ mental health, and the physicians working in this field are called psychiatrists.

 

Psychiatry addresses a wide range of mental health issues, including depression, anxiety disorders, bipolar disorder, schizophrenia, obsessive-compulsive disorder, post-traumatic stress disorder, eating disorders, and addiction. Psychiatrists use various therapeutic approaches to diagnose these conditions, determine appropriate treatment methods, and provide the necessary support for patients’ recovery and well-being.

The psychiatry department engages in one-on-one consultations with patients to understand their symptoms and challenges. Psychiatrists conduct psychosocial assessments to evaluate patients’ living conditions, relationships, and past medical and psychiatric history. Additionally, they may review the patients’ physical health by utilizing medical tools such as laboratory tests or imaging techniques.

Psychiatrists employ various methods during the treatment process. These include medication therapy, psychotherapy, cognitive-behavioral therapy, family therapy, and group therapy, among others. Psychiatrists also create a supportive environment for their patients, addressing their emotional needs and guiding them towards recovery and maintaining good mental health.

The psychiatry department often requires a multidisciplinary approach and collaboration with other healthcare professionals. They work alongside psychologists, social workers, nurses, and other healthcare providers to meet the holistic healthcare needs of patients.

In conclusion, the psychiatry department is a medical discipline that deals with mental health issues. Psychiatrists assess patients’ mental health, develop treatment plans, and provide the necessary support and care for patients’ recovery and well-being.
